This page is based on the fine work of:



1. Install your quadbri card and set the jumpers correct
(I'll update this, I have to look up the doc first)

2. Install Asterisk@Home
Just insert the CD and wait.
When installation is finished log in and start installation

3. Stop asterisk and amportal
asterisk stop

4. Remove the zaptel service that is installed by default
at the root prompt type "setup"
Select system services on the list and scroll down to zaptel. Press space to remove the selection
End the setup program

5. Boot your PC
type "reboot" at the prompt

6. Download latest version of the junghanns.net drivers.
Point your browser tohttp://www.junghanns.net/en/download.html
Today the latest version that run on asterisk 1.2 is: 0.3.0-PRE-1c (* 1.2.0)
cd /usr/src
wget http://www.junghanns.net/downloads/bristuff-0.3.0-PRE-1c.tar.gz
tar -zxvf bristuff-0.3.0-PRE-1c.tar.gz
cd bristuff-0.3.0-PRE-1c

8. Install it
./install.sh
You must hit enter several times during compilation


9. Configure it
The quadbri has 4 ISDN ports. My jumpers are set so that
port 1 = Gigaset 1
Port 2 = Gigaset 2
Port 3 = ISDN 1
Port 4 = ISDN 2

9a. Set up your /etc/zaptel.conf
This is my file

  1. Autogenerated by /usr/local/sbin/genzaptelconf — do not hand edit
  2. Zaptel Configuration File
  3. This file is parsed by the Zaptel Configurator, ztcfg

  1. It must be in the module loading order


  1. Span 1: ZTDUMMY/1 "ZTDUMMY/1 1"

  1. Global data


loadzone=no
defaultzone=no
  1. qozap span definitions
  2. most of the values should be bogus because we are not really zaptel
span=1,1,3,ccs,ami
span=2,2,3,ccs,ami
span=3,0,3,ccs,ami
span=4,0,3,ccs,ami

bchan=1,2
dchan=3
bchan=4,5
dchan=6
bchan=7,8
dchan=9
bchan=10,11
dchan=12


9b. Set up your /etc/asterisk/zapata.conf
This is my file

;
; Zapata telephony interface
;
; Configuration file

[trunkgroups]

[channels]
switchtype = euroisdn
signalling = bri_cpe_ptmp
pridialplan = local
echocancel=yes


; S/T port 1 Gigaset 1
group = 1
signalling=bri_net_ptmp
context=from-internal
channel => 1,2


; S/T port 2 Gigaset 2
group = 2
signalling=bri_net_ptmp
context=from-internal
channel => 4,5


; S/T port 3 connected to BRI connected to 88888888 and 88888889
group = 3
signalling = bri_cpe_ptmp
immediate=no
context=from-pstn
channel => 7,8


; S/T port 4 connected to BRI connected to 77777777 and 77777778 (OD)
group = 4
signalling = bri_cpe_ptmp
immediate=no
context=from-pstn
channel => 10,11



;Include genzaptelconf configs
  1. include zapata-auto.conf

;Include AMP configs
  1. include zapata_additional.conf


10. Load the drivers
The 4 LEDs on the card are now off
